ACKNOWLEDGEMENTS

We understand that many of the dance forms that our studio shares with our students have their roots in Black dance. As acknowledgement, we contribute to Dance Immersion, an organization that has been supporting artistic work of the African diaspora all along, and educating the rest of us along the way. 

We acknowledge that indigenous peoples, including the Haudensaunee (Iroquois), Ojibway/Chippewa and Anishnabek peoples, are the traditional keepers of this land. This territory is covered by Treaty 18, 1818. As part of our studio's work towards reconciliation with the original peoples of Turtle Island, we contribute to the Youth Programming Fund at Indigenous Dance Theatre, Red Sky Performance.
